The Ogun State Ministry of Culture and Tourism has invited Prince Femi Fadina, the Chairman of Tourism Committee of Ado-Odo/Ota Local Government, as guest speaker of the 42nd edition of World Tourism day Celebration holding in Abeokuta, the state capital.

This is made known in a statement made available by Mr Lukman Omikunle, the Media officer of the Tourism Committee in Ado-Odo/Ota LG.

According to the statement, Omikunle informed that Prince Fadina will be attending the 2019 edition of the tourism festival in Abeokuta as the guest speaker of the event following an invitation from the Ministry of Culture and Tourism, Abeokuta, Ogun State.

“I wish to announce that the Chairman of the Tourism Committee of Ado-Odo/Ota Local Government has been invited as the guest speaker to the 42nd edition of World Tourism day Celebration coming up on the 27th of September, 2019, in Abeokuta.

“Prince Fadina, the Chief Executive Officer of Dinat Consulting, will be speaking on the theme, ‘Tourism and Jobs: A Better Future for All – The theme is designed to highlight the vital roles of tourism in improving the social-economic status of the people,” Omikunle stated

Prince Fadina, also the sole proprietor of Jethro Tours Institute, is a respected culture and tourism investor with over three decades of massive successful records.

The 2019 tourism celebration will take place at the June 12 Cultural Centre starting by 10:00 am
